Understanding Phlebotomy
Phlebotomy involves the process of taking blood samples from patients for various tests, transfusions, or donations. Phlebotomists play a vital role in the healthcare system, ensuring accurate diagnostics and patient care. Here are a few key responsibilities:
- Collecting blood samples through venipuncture or capillary puncture.
- Ensuring patient comfort and safety during procedures.
- Labeling and storing samples correctly.
- Maintaining clean and safe working conditions.

Benefits of a Phlebotomy Career
Choosing phlebotomy as a career not onyl ensures job security but also offers numerous personal and professional benefits:
- Flexible Schedules: Many phlebotomy positions allow for flexible hours, accommodating both full-time and part-time work.
- Fast Entry into the Workforce: With relatively short training programs, you can quickly enter the job market.
- Essential Healthcare Role: As a phlebotomist, you hold a position that directly contributes to patient health outcomes.
Practical Tips for Aspiring Phlebotomists
Here are some practical tips to help you succeed in your phlebotomy career in Springfield, MA:
- Get Certified: Consider obtaining national certification to enhance your credentials and job prospects.
- network: Connect with other healthcare professionals through local associations or job fairs to learn about job openings.
- Build Soft Skills: effective communication and strong interpersonal skills are essential for patient interactions.
- Stay Updated: Healthcare practices and technologies are continually evolving, so keep your knowledge current.

First-Hand Experiences: What It’s Like to Be a Phlebotomist
Here are insights shared by professionals about their experiences in the field:
- Patient Interaction: Phlebotomists often form positive relationships with patients, providing reassurance and care during potentially uncomfortable procedures.
- Daily Challenges: Each day presents its own set of challenges,from difficult draws to working with patients who are anxious,keeping the job interesting.
- Team Collaboration: Phlebotomists frequently work as part of a healthcare team, collaborating with doctors and nurses to improve patient care.
